Cycurion, a cybersecurity firm, has announced its acquisition of Secuvant for $2.875 million. This deal aims to enhance Cycurion's capabilities in managed detection and response (MDR), threat management, and compliance. The acquisition is expected to contribute approximately $3 million in annualized revenue and $1.5 million in EBITDA for fiscal 2026. Secuvant's tools, including Panoptic and cyberRPM, will integrate with Cycurion's existing platforms, HavenX and ARx, to bolster automated threat defense. The transaction includes cash, preferred stock, and a performance-based earn-out. The deal is anticipated to close within 7–10 days, pending customary conditions. Following the announcement, Cycurion's stock rose by 6.77%, indicating a positive market reaction. This acquisition is part of Cycurion's broader strategy to build an AI-driven cybersecurity platform.
